编程系统属于什么软件

fiy 其他 2

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程系统属于软件开发工具之一。软件开发工具是程序员在开发、测试和维护软件过程中所使用的工具集合。编程系统是其中之一,它主要用于编写和编辑源代码。

    编程系统通常包括以下几个方面的功能:

    1. 源代码编辑器:提供基本的文本编辑功能,如语法高亮、自动缩进、代码补全等。常见的编程语言如C、Java、Python等都有相应的编辑器支持。

    2. 语言解释器或编译器:根据所使用的编程语言,提供解释或编译源代码的功能。解释器会逐行解释源代码并进行执行,而编译器则将源代码转换成机器语言的可执行文件。

    3. 调试器:用于帮助程序员定位和修复程序中的错误。调试器提供了断点调试、变量监视、单步执行等功能,可以帮助开发者逐行调试程序,找出程序中的bug。

    4. 版本控制系统:用于管理源代码的版本和变更。开发团队可以使用版本控制系统进行代码的协作开发、版本管理、bug跟踪等操作。

    5. 构建工具:用于自动化构建、测试和部署软件。构建工具能够帮助程序员编写脚本,自动处理编译、打包、测试和发布等繁琐的工作。

    总之,编程系统是一种帮助开发者进行软件开发的工具,它们提供了各种功能来简化和加速开发过程。程序员可以根据自己的需求选择适合自己的编程系统来提高工作效率。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程系统属于一种特定类型的软件,它是专门用来支持程序员进行软件开发和编程工作的工具。编程系统通常包括各种功能和工具,以提供程序员所需的环境和资源,以便他们能够设计、编写、测试和调试程序代码。

    以下是编程系统的一些常见特点和功能:

    1. 集成开发环境(IDE):编程系统通常提供一个集成的开发环境,其中包含了用于编辑代码的文本编辑器、自动代码补全、语法高亮显示、代码调试器和错误检查等功能。这种集成的开发环境能够提高开发效率并提供更好的代码编写体验。

    2. 编程语言支持:编程系统通常支持多种编程语言,例如C、C++、Java、Python、JavaScript等。通过提供针对特定语言的语法检查和代码提示等功能,编程系统能够帮助程序员写出更准确、高效的代码。

    3. 编译器和解释器:编程系统通常包含用于将源代码转换为可执行文件或字节码的编译器或解释器。编译器将源代码转换为机器码,而解释器逐行解释源代码并执行。

    4. 调试功能:编程系统通常提供调试功能,例如设置断点、单步执行代码、查看变量值和堆栈跟踪等。这些调试功能能够帮助程序员找出代码中的错误和问题,并进行逐步调试。

    5. 版本控制集成:许多编程系统还集成了版本控制系统,例如Git,以支持团队协作和代码版本管理。这使得程序员可以轻松地与其他开发人员共享代码,并跟踪代码的变更历史。

    总之,编程系统是一种为程序员提供开发环境和工具的软件,能够帮助他们进行软件开发和编程工作。它们的功能和特点能够提高开发效率、减少错误,并提供更好的代码编写和调试体验。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程系统通常指的是一类用于开发、编写和运行计算机程序的软件系统。它是程序员在编写代码的过程中使用的工具和环境。编程系统包括编程语言、编译器、集成开发环境(IDE)等。

    编程语言是一种用于编写程序的形式语言。常见的编程语言包括C、C++、Java、Python等。编程语言定义了一套语法规则和标准库,程序员可以使用语言提供的关键字、语法结构和函数来编写代码。

    编译器是用于将程序源代码转换为可执行文件或库文件的工具。编译器将源代码作为输入,经过词法分析、语法分析、语义分析等过程,生成目标代码或中间代码。常见的编译器有GCC、Clang、Visual Studio等。

    集成开发环境(Integrated Development Environment,IDE)是一种集成了编辑器、调试器、编译器等工具的软件系统。它提供了一个统一的界面,便于程序员开发、调试和测试程序。常见的IDE有Eclipse、Visual Studio、IntelliJ IDEA等。

    编程系统的操作流程通常包括以下几个步骤:

    1. 安装编程语言和编译器:选择一种合适的编程语言,并安装相应的编程工具,如编译器、IDE等。这些工具可以从官方网站或第三方平台上下载和安装。

    2. 编写源代码:使用文本编辑器或IDE创建一个源代码文件,并在文件中编写程序代码。根据编程语言的语法规则和标准库,使用合适的语法结构和函数编写代码。可以使用注释来解释代码的逻辑、功能和说明。

    3. 编译源代码:使用编译器将源代码转换为可执行文件或库文件。根据编程语言的规范,编译器会进行词法分析、语法分析、语义分析等过程,检查代码的正确性,并生成目标代码或中间代码。

    4. 调试和测试代码:使用调试器和测试框架对编写的代码进行调试和测试。调试器可以帮助程序员查找和修复代码中的错误和问题,测试框架可以用来编写和执行各种测试用例,验证代码的正确性和性能。

    5. 运行和部署程序:将编译生成的可执行文件或库文件运行在目标平台上。根据程序的需求,可以将程序部署到服务器、移动设备或其他计算平台上,进行功能展示或运行。

    总结起来,编程系统是一种用于开发、编写和运行计算机程序的软件系统,包括编程语言、编译器、集成开发环境等。编程系统的操作流程包括安装编程工具、编写源代码、编译、调试和测试、运行和部署等步骤。程序员可以通过使用编程系统来实现自己的编程任务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部